[PATCH-for-9.1 12/12] exec/poison: Poison CONFIG_SOFTMMU again


From: Philippe Mathieu-Daudé
Subject: [PATCH-for-9.1 12/12] exec/poison: Poison CONFIG_SOFTMMU again
Date: Wed, 13 Mar 2024 22:33:39 +0100

Now that the confusion around SOFTMMU vs SYSTEM emulation
was clarified, we can restore the CONFIG_SOFTMMU poison
pragma.

This reverts commit d31b84041d4353ef310ffde23c87b78c2aa32ead
("exec/poison: Do not poison CONFIG_SOFTMMU").
